Summary

The job is for an Operations Specialist at ECP, a market-leading SaaS company that provides senior living communities with software solutions. The specialist will act as the HubSpot admin, identify areas for improvement, develop efficient processes within the CRM system, and work cross-functionally to ensure alignment with business objectives.
